Project Getty Foundation. The Palace of Venice in Rome and its collection of sculpture

The Getty Foundation has funded a research project on the collection and cataloging of sculptures preserved in the Museo Nazionale del Palazzo di Venezia in Rome. As for the wooden statues of the Palace of Venice, that is certainly the most important collection of wooden sculptures in Italy. First, in terms of quantity. Taking into account only the figurative works, there are over one hundred and seventy pieces. Ivalsa participated in the project through the identification of about a hundred wooden statues and bas-reliefs, also drawing up a report on the conservation status of the material.
